Nori ( 海苔) is a dried edible seaweed used in Japanese cuisine, made from species of the red algae genus Pyropia, including P. yezonesis and P. tenera. [1] It has a …

WebMay 1, 2024 · These make red seaweed an excellent alternative source for dietary proteins. Compared to wild seaweed, farmed seaweed is the primary source for producing seaweed products. In 2015, about 28.4 million tons of farmed seaweed were produced, while only 1.09 million tons of wild seaweed were harvested ( FAO, 2024 ).

Saccharina latissima is a type of brown marine algae of the family Laminariaceae that grows in cold water as a winter crop. Its common name in English is sugar kelp. One reason for this name is that when dried, a sweet-tasting powder forms on the fronds.
